Начало карьеры в IT-сфере всегда сопровождается множеством возможностей и вызовов. Быстро меняющиеся технологии, высокая конкуренция и необходимость постоянного профессионального развития делают процесс планирования карьерного роста особенно важным для молодых специалистов. Эффективное планирование помогает не только определить четкие цели, но и более осознанно подходить к выбору направлений обучения и развитию своих навыков.
В данной статье рассмотрим ключевые советы, которые помогут молодым айтишникам выстроить стратегию своего карьерного развития, максимально используя имеющиеся ресурсы и возможности. Внимание также уделим инструментам, способным повысить продуктивность на этом пути.
Понимание собственной мотивации и целей
Первым шагом в планировании карьерного роста является четкое понимание своих интересов, сильных сторон и долгосрочных целей. Без ясного видения будущего легко потеряться в разнообразии IT-направлений и неэффективно расходовать время.
Рекомендуется проанализировать, какие технологии, проекты или задачи вызывают живой интерес, и на основе этого сформулировать несколько конкретных целей на ближайший год, три года и пять лет. Это позволит строить карьеру не хаотично, а осознанно и последовательно.
Определение сильных и слабых сторон
Реалистичная оценка своих навыков помогает выставить приоритеты в развитии. Например, если у вас хорошее понимание алгоритмов, но слабая база в системном администрировании, стоит сфокусироваться на усилении именно уязвимых позиций, сохраняя и развивая свои преимущества.
Для самоанализа можно использовать различные инструменты, такие как личные SWOT-анализы или профессиональные тестирования. Важно учесть обратную связь от коллег и наставников, которые помогут увидеть себя со стороны.
Формулирование SMART-целей
Цели должны быть конкретными, измеримыми, достижимыми, релевантными и ограниченными по времени (SMART). Например, вместо общей цели «стать разработчиком», лучше поставить задачу «освоить языки Python и JavaScript на уровне junior-разработчика в течение 6 месяцев».
Подобный подход помогает мониторить прогресс, корректировать траекторию развития и сохранять мотивацию на высоком уровне.
Постоянное обучение и развитие навыков
IT-индустрия отличается высокой динамичностью, и без регулярного обновления знаний сложно оставаться конкурентоспособным. Поэтому успешные молодые специалисты всегда находятся в состоянии постоянного обучения.
Современные технологии открывают множество возможностей для получения новых знаний: онлайн-курсы, вебинары, конференции и специализированные тренинги. Важно выбрать именно те инструменты, которые помогут максимально эффективно освоить необходимые компетенции.
Выбор направления обучения
После определения целей необходимо составить учебный план, сфокусированный на ключевых компетенциях вашей специализации. Можно разделить обучение на технические навыки (программирование, разработка, DevOps) и мягкие навыки (коммуникация, тайм-менеджмент, работа в команде).
Полезно использовать таблицу для планирования учебных этапов и контроля прогресса:
Навык | Ресурсы для обучения | Цель | Срок |
---|---|---|---|
Программирование на Python | Онлайн-курс, практика на проектах | Достичь уровня junior | 3 месяца |
Основы DevOps | Видеоуроки, документация | Понимать принципы работы CI/CD | 4 месяца |
Тайм-менеджмент | Книги, тренинги | Эффективно планировать день | 1 месяц |
Практические проекты и участие в сообществах
Теоретические знания надо подкреплять практикой. Участие в реальных проектах, стажировках и open-source разработках способствует закреплению навыков и расширяет профессиональную сеть контактов.
Кроме того, активность в IT-сообществах (форумы, митапы, конференции) помогает обмениваться опытом и узнавать о новейших тенденциях.
Развитие мягких навыков и профессиональных привычек
В современном IT карьера строится не только на технических знаниях, но и на умении работать в команде, коммуницировать и эффективно управлять своим временем. Мягкие навыки часто становятся решающим фактором при продвижении по карьерной лестнице.
Важность этих навыков сложно переоценить, ведь их развитие позволяет создавать качественные продукты и строить доверительные отношения с коллегами и руководством.
Коммуникационные навыки
Умение ясно выражать свои мысли, принимать аргументы коллег и вести переговоры помогает избежать многих профессиональных недоразумений. Молодым специалистам рекомендуется тренировать навыки презентаций и письменной речи.
Регулярное участие в командных обсуждениях и технических митингах является отличной практикой для развития коммуникации.
Тайм-менеджмент и организация работы
Умение планировать задачи, расставлять приоритеты и избегать прокрастинации напрямую влияет на продуктивность. Для систематизации работы можно использовать техники, например, Pomodoro, Eisenhower Matrix или GTD.
Поддержание дисциплины и регулярное рефлексирование помогут выявлять слабые места и улучшать подход к работе.
Поиск наставников и налаживание профессиональных связей
Наличие опытного наставника — одно из ключевых преимуществ в построении успешной карьеры. Наставник не только помогает быстрее осваивать новые знания, но и делится практическими советами и связями.
Кроме индивидуального менторства, важна и широкая сеть профессиональных контактов, которая открывает новые возможности и знания.
Как найти наставника
Можно обратиться к старшим коллегам на работе, участвовать в программах менторства IT-компаний или искать помощь в профессиональных сообществах. Главное — проявлять инициативу и открытую коммуникацию.
Регулярные встречи и обсуждения прогресса помогают строить доверительные отношения и позволяют наставнику лучше понять ваши сильные и слабые стороны.
Налаживание связей через мероприятия и онлайн-платформы
Активное участие в конференциях, хакатонах и митапах дает возможность познакомиться с экспертами и единомышленниками. Социальные сети и профессиональные платформы позволяют поддерживать контакты и обмениваться знаниями.
Это особенно важно в начале карьеры, когда информация о скрытых вакансиях и возможностях часто распространяется через личные рекомендации.
Гибкость и адаптация к изменениям
Рынок IT постоянно меняется: появляются новые технологии, изменяются требования работодателей, трансформируются бизнес-процессы. Успешный специалист умеет быстро адаптироваться и быть готовым к переменам.
Гибкость — это не только способность учиться новому, но и готовность менять направление карьеры в соответствии с меняющимися обстоятельствами.
Мониторинг трендов и технологических новинок
Регулярный анализ индустриальных новостей и прогнозов позволяет предвидеть востребованные навыки и технологии. Подписка на профессиональные издания, участие в тематических форумах и изучение новых инструментов помогают сохранить актуальность знаний.
Иногда стоит инвестировать время в изучение перспективных, на первый взгляд, областей, которые в будущем могут резко повысить вашу ценность на рынке труда.
Разработка плана «Б»
В жизни и карьере могут возникать неожиданные ситуации, поэтому важно иметь альтернативные варианты развития. Например, если выбранное направление перестает быть востребованным, стоит иметь запасной план с другими навыками или профессиями, связанными с IT.
Это снижает уровень стресса и обеспечивает устойчивость карьерного пути даже в условиях нестабильности.
Заключение
Планирование карьерного роста — это многогранный процесс, требующий осознанного подхода, постоянного саморазвития и активного взаимодействия с профессиональным сообществом. Молодым специалистам в IT-сфере важно не только накапливать технические знания, но и развивать мягкие навыки, искать наставников и быть готовыми к переменам.
Сформированные на ранних этапах привычки и стратегии определяют скорость и качество карьерного прогресса. Следуя представленным советам, вы сможете выстроить устойчивую и успешную карьеру в одной из самых динамичных и востребованных отраслей современности.